Polish Driving License Requirements: A Comprehensive Guide
Getting a driving license is an essential step for many individuals, providing a gateway to self-reliance and mobility. In Poland, as in numerous other countries, there are specific requirements and actions that a person should follow to protect a legitimate Polish driving license. This blog post will offer an extensive appearance at the requirements, procedures, and vital standards for obtaining a driving license in Poland.
Types of Polish Driving Licenses
Before delving into the requirements, it is essential to understand the different types of driving licenses available in Poland:
| License Category | Vehicles Permitted | Minimum Age |
|---|---|---|
| A1 | Motorcycles (as much as 125cc) | 16 years |
| A2 | Bikes (up to 400cc) | 18 years |
| A | Bikes (all categories) | 24 years |
| B | Cars and trucks approximately 3.5 tons (consisting of light vans) | 18 years |
| C | Trucks over 3.5 lots | 21 years |
| D | Buses | 24 years |
| BE | Cars in category B with a trailer over 750 kg | 18 years |
| C1 | Light trucks in between 3.5 - 7.5 heaps | 18 years |
| D1 | Mini buses with an optimum of 16 travelers | 21 years |
Requirements for a Polish Driving License
1. Age Requirements
As highlighted in the table above, possible drivers need to meet specific age requirements depending on the kind of license they want to obtain.
2. Residency
To make an application for a Polish driving license, candidates ought to be residents of Poland. Foreign nationals can obtain a driving license if they have a legitimate house permit or are citizens of EU/EEA nations.
3. Medical exam
A medical exam is required to ascertain physical fitness to drive. This evaluation must be done by a certified physician who will release a medical certificate.
4. Theoretical Exam
All applicants must pass a theoretical driving test. This exam generally includes concerns associated with traffic regulations, roadway signs, and safety practices.
5. Practical Driving Test
As soon as the theoretical test is passed, candidates need to complete a useful driving test that assesses driving skills. This test ought to be carried out in a designated vehicle and under the guidance of a licensed inspector.

6. Document Requirements
The following documents are typically required for requesting a driving license:
| Document | Description |
|---|---|
| Valid ID | Such as a passport or nationwide ID |
| Evidence of residency | Residence permit or document validating residency in Poland |
| Medical certificate | Accreditation of fitness to drive |
| Finished application | Readily available at the regional interaction workplace (Wydział Komunikacji) |
| Photos | Current passport-sized photos |
| Cost payment invoice | Payment for the application and tests |
7. Learning to Drive
In Poland, it is not obligatory to register in a driving school; nevertheless, it is extremely advised. Driving schools offer structured learning, which can be helpful for passing both the theoretical and useful tests.

FAQs About Polish Driving License Requirements
1. Can I drive in Poland with an international driving permit?
Yes, holders of an international driving permit (IDP) can drive in Poland for approximately 12 months. After this period, you must obtain a Polish driving license if you are a homeowner.
2. For how long does it require to get a Polish driving license?
The timeline differs however generally ranges from a couple of weeks to a number of months, depending on the person's preparedness for the exams and processing times at the pertinent offices.
3. What if I fail the theoretical or practical test?
Typically, candidates can retake the tests after a waiting period, which may range from one week to numerous months, depending on the regional regulations.
4. Are there any residency criteria for foreigners?
Yes, foreigners must be official residents of Poland, either through a home permit or EU/EEA citizenship, to look for a driving license.
5. What fees are associated with obtaining a driving license?
Fees vary depending on the area but normally include costs for the medical checkup, driving lessons, test fees, and the driving license application charge.
